Umar Pur is a village in Nawabganj Tehsil of Bara Banki district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 164466.
About Umar Pur village record
Umar Pur is listed under Nawabganj Tehsil in Bara Banki district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.
The Census 2011 record reports population 474, 86 households, area 84.72 hectares.
